The agroindustrial sector in Bolivar as a bet for competitiveness and regional development

The pretension of this article is to expose the profile of the agricultural and agro-industrial sector of the department of Bolivar like part of the internal agenda of competitiveness and productivity, like source of progress and development of this region, like guide of better indicators of sustainable development. it will leave from an analysis of the agro-industrial profile in Colombia, of the representative proposals and cultures, soon it will be centered in economic and social indicators of the region to end up giving him to passage to the new projects and linkings that the department like productive bets has, motor of regional development and guides in the search of better conditions of life for its settlers.
